HSBC says India could attract up to $25 billion in foreign equity inflows if underweight global emerging-market funds restore allocations to neutral. Improving earnings, resilient domestic demand and lower relative volatility strengthen the case, with the brokerage favouring financials, autos, retail, hospitals and select industrial stocks
